Skip to content

Hydronautics team repository for managing common Dockerfiles

Notifications You must be signed in to change notification settings

hydronautics-team/dockerfiles

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

33 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

dockerfiles

Repository for managing common Dockerfiles


SAUVC container with all dependencies

Run this container when you need to debug

Build sauvc container on Jetson TX2

sudo docker build -t sauvc -f Dockerfile.tx2.noetic.pytorch .

Run sauvc on Jetson TX2

First, clone sauvc repo

git clone https://github.com/hidronautics/sauvc.git
git submodule update --init --recursive

Then build container and run

sudo ./run_sauvc_tx2.sh 

To build sauvc code inside container

cd sauvc
catkin_make 
source devel/setup.bash

SAUVC autostart container

Run this container for competitions

Build sauvc_autostart container on Jetson TX2

sudo docker build -t sauvc_autostart -f Dockerfile.tx2.autostart_sauvc .

Then to autostart code on Jetson

sudo ./run_sauvc_autostart.sh 

To attach to container

sudo docker attach sauvc_container

To stop autostart and delete container

sudo docker update --restart=no sauvc_container
sudo docker rm -f sauvc_container

Releases

No releases published

Packages

No packages published